Print.js icon indicating copy to clipboard operation
Print.js copied to clipboard

vue中设置font-size不生效

Open java6688 opened this issue 2 years ago • 4 comments

vue项目中设置font-size后,字体盒子尺寸应用了字体大小,但是字体大小本身没有变化

java6688 avatar Aug 16 '23 16:08 java6688

如果你想所有字体都统一的话,直接在params了添加一个配置项“font_size”: params

如果想每个文本显示不同字体大小,我是直接把“node_modules”>“print-js”>“src”下的所有文件copy到项目代码里,然后删掉“function.js”文件里面的一节代码就能用了。 collectStyles 这个插件无法实现不同字体尺寸的原因就在这里,它给打印节点内的所有子节点都进行遍历,然后又加了“font-size: ' + params.font_size + ' !important;”限制了字体大小只能统一一个尺寸,所以我就把这块删了。 原本是这样的: init

GGqianmo avatar Dec 19 '23 07:12 GGqianmo

好像也没有效果也

qiushuanglin avatar Apr 03 '24 07:04 qiushuanglin

好像也没有效果也 需要修改的是node-model里面,然后需要重启项目

Luochao0511 avatar Apr 21 '24 15:04 Luochao0511

是不是需要安装显卡?我3060显卡就可以,集成显卡就不行

qqqkoko123 avatar Jun 17 '24 03:06 qqqkoko123